MERCY HEALTH FOUNDATION INC, founded in 1971, is a small nonprofit that reported $223K in total revenue in fiscal year 2023. Revenue fell 80% from the prior year — a significant decline worth monitoring. The organization ran a surplus of $153K, a strong 69% operating margin.

Mission

TO ACTIVELY SEEK AND INVEST CHARITABLE SUPPORT FOR MINISTRY HEALTH CARE, INC., SO THAT THEY MAY IMPROVE THE HEALTH AND WELL-BEING OF ALL THE PEOPLE IN THE COMMUNITIES THEY SERVE.
